It's time again to assemble your dream team of the stiffest stiffs that somehow still get meaningful playing time. Baseball Prospectus' fantasy game is now open for business. For those not familiar with it, the objective is to assemble the worst team you can that includes players who still get meaningful major league playing time. Scoring is based on Exuded Stiff Points, Net (ESPN). For hitters the formula is (.800 - OPS) times plate appearances. For pitchers it is (ERA - 4.50) times innings pitched divided by 3. Low OPS and high ERA is good. Last year, our very own Ronny Cedeno had the highest ESPN in baseball (109), followed closely by Rockies shortstop Clint Barmes (108).

 

Here is the link to the contest's home page. You must be a BP subscriber to participate, but the basic subscription is fine; you don't need the premium subscription. The winner receives $500 plus a signed, framed photograph reproduction of Bud $elig. Unfortunately it isn't possible to set up leagues for this contest, but we can simulate a league by having everyone post their team name and roster in this thread, then a few times throughout the year I'll ask everyone to check and post their scores and we can come up with league standings. You can change your roster until midnight Pacific time Friday, April 6, at which time rosters become frozen for the rest of the year (even if your stiffs get injured, sent to the minors, or, horror of all horrors, actually has a good year).
